唯一索引在空间数据库中扮演重要角色,确保每个索引值对应唯一数据记录。在SQL Server中,当字段设置为UNIQUE约束时,自动建立非聚簇的唯一索引;而对于PRIMARY KEY字段,则建立唯一聚簇索引。
空间数据库中的唯一索引解析
相关推荐
地理空间数据库
地理空间数据库是一种专门用于存储、管理和查询地理空间数据的数据库。它不仅包含传统的属性数据,还包含空间信息,例如点、线、面等几何形状。这使得地理空间数据库能够高效地处理和分析与地理位置相关的数据。
地理空间数据库被广泛应用于各个领域,例如:
城市规划: 分析城市土地利用、交通流量等信息,辅助城市规划决策。
环境监测: 存储和分析环境监测数据,例如空气质量、水质等,帮助监测环境变化。
自然资源管理: 管理土地、森林、水资源等自然资源信息,支持可持续发展。
商业分析: 分析顾客分布、门店选址等商业数据,优化商业策略。
地理空间数据库的技术不断发展,新的数据模型、索引方法和查询语言不断涌现,为处理和分析海量地理空间数据提供了更强大的支持。
SQLServer
3
2024-05-12
详述空间数据库
这份PPT详细介绍了基于SQL SERVER的空间数据库,并深入解析了ArcCatalog和ArcSDE在空间数据库中的应用,内容丰富、涵盖面广,讲解易懂。
SQLServer
2
2024-08-01
空间数据库建库
利用 CASE 工具创建空间数据库:CASE 工具使您可以扩展 ArcInfo 8 数据模型并创建定制的要素。面向对象的设计工具(OOA&D)可用于表示空间数据库的设计,它们使用 UML 来表示设计方案。CASE 工具具有两个主要功能:生成代码和生成方案。
SQLServer
2
2024-06-01
深度解析空间数据库的网络模型
网络模型特别适用于数据之间复杂的关系。在这种结构中,数据间的联系通过指针表示,这可能增加额外的维护负担。
SQLServer
0
2024-08-01
在PostgreSQL中构建空间数据库
David Blasby在Refractions Research的文章中介绍,PostGIS成为符合“OpenGIS SQL简单特性”标准的空间数据库,在PostgreSQL中添加了空间扩展。
PostgreSQL
1
2024-07-13
Oracle 空间数据库配置
ArcGIS 10.1 及更高版本将 SDE 功能集成到 ArcCatalog 中,配置 Oracle 空间数据库以存储空间地理数据的步骤如下:
Oracle
4
2024-04-30
空间数据库复习概述
空间数据库是指地理信息系统在计算机物理存储介质上存储的与应用相关的地理空间数据的总和,通常以特定结构的文件形式组织。与关系数据库不同,空间数据库具有以下特征:
数据量庞大:存储的数据量非常大,城市数据可达几十G,影像数据可达几百G。
高可访问性:需要强大的信息检索和分析能力,以高效访问大量数据。
空间数据模型复杂:涵盖了几乎所有与地理相关的数据类型。
属性数据和空间数据联合管理:同时管理属性数据和空间数据。
应用范围广泛:广泛应用于地理研究、环境保护、国土资源管理等领域。
其他特征包括:1. 非结构化特征:空间数据是一种非结构化数据。2. 空间关系特征:例如拓扑的面状表面记录组成弧段的标识。3. 时态特征:需要时空信息进行监测和管理。4. 多尺度特征:可根据地学过程分为不同层次。5. 空间特征:每个空间对象具有隐含的空间分布特征。
空间数据库管理系统分为四个阶段:1. 文件系统2. 文件关系混合系统3. 空间数据库引擎4. 对象关系型数据库管理系统
标准包括:1. SFA SQL2. SQL/MMSFA SQL在空间数据存储实现上比SQL/MM更宽泛。空间数据模型分为:1. 矢量模型(几何对象模型、几何拓扑模型、网络模型)2. 栅格模型3. 注记文本模型几何对象层次关系可用九交矩阵描述,表达拓扑关系。物理模型中,WKB是一种二进制存储格式,而WKT是文本格式的几何数据表达方式。
PostgreSQL
0
2024-11-05
探索空间数据库的奥秘
空间数据库核心研究方向
数据模型与结构:
空间分类学:构建空间实体的分类体系,明确不同类型空间对象的特征和关系。
空间数据模型:设计用于表示和存储空间数据的模型,例如矢量模型和栅格模型。
高效数据管理:
文件组织:研究如何有效组织和存储海量空间数据,例如使用空间填充曲线或网格索引。
索引技术:探索适用于空间数据的索引机制,例如 R-tree、Quadtree 等,以加速空间查询。
查询与分析:
查询语言:设计专门用于表达空间查询的语言,例如 SQL 的空间扩展。
查询处理:研究如何高效处理空间查询,例如使用空间索引和过滤技术。
查询优化:探索针对不同空间查询的优化策略,以提升查询效率。
知识发现:
数据挖掘:应用数据挖掘算法从空间数据中提取有价值的模式和知识,例如空间聚类、关联规则挖掘等。
数据挖掘
2
2024-05-21
深入解析空间数据库中的查询视图延续问题
在95031班学生的视图VIEW3中,如何找出所有男生的信息?执行此查询时,系统首先从数据库中检索VIEW3的定义,然后将其与用户的查询结合,转换为基本表student的等效查询。这个转换过程称为视图消解(View Resolution)。
SQLServer
0
2024-08-04